Project Manager, Strategic Customer Onboarding
About the role
McKesson is an impact-driven, Fortune 10 company that touches virtually every aspect of healthcare. We deliver insights, products, and services that make quality care more accessible and affordable. This role requires a forward-thinking individual who thrives in a fast-paced, ever-evolving environment where change is embraced. The ideal candidate will be comfortable with the concept of "building the car as we drive it" and will excel in managing projects that support varying segments which may change over time. Familiarity with project management tools like Smartsheet and SharePoint is essential, or a willingness to learn and adopt these tools is required.
Responsibilities
- Conduct project meetings and ensure project deliverables are met from initiation through delivery, interfacing with customers and McKesson stakeholders.
- Serve as the primary point of contact for projects, guiding them from kickoff to final implementation, even as project parameters evolve.
- Collaborate with various departments (e.g., Credit, Regulatory, Pricing, Sales) to ensure seamless project execution.
- Proactively plan and adjust schedules, coordinating all aspects of projects while fostering a culture open to change and innovation.
- Develop detailed work plans, schedules, and status reports, adjusting them as needed to reflect project evolution.
- Assess project risks and issues, developing flexible resolutions to meet timeline goals and objectives.
- Strive to meet or exceed implementation goals, adjusting as necessary to maintain alignment with changing customer satisfaction targets.
- Develop and execute dynamic strategies to establish successful, long-term relationships with field sales teams.
- Present project-related information to executives, adapting presentations to reflect changes in project direction.
- Champion the development of internal and external partnerships to enhance responsiveness to changing customer needs.
- Lead new initiatives with enthusiasm, acting as a catalyst for change and fostering a culture of continuous improvement.
- Drive the development and rollout of new or updated McKesson policies as needed, demonstrating flexibility and responsiveness.
Requirements
- Degree or equivalent and typically requires 4+ years of relevant experience.
- 4+ years of experience in sales/customer service or project management within healthcare or a similar industry.
- 2 years of project management experience.
- Thorough knowledge of sales, group purchasing organizations, government, institutional, and long-term care entities, with demonstrated leadership skills.
- 4-year degree in a related field or equivalent experience.

Working Conditions
- Hybrid position: expected to work on-site at the Las Colinas office a minimum of two days per week, with the remaining days worked remotely. Specific in-office days may be designated based on team needs.
- Travel: position may require up to 10% overnight business travel during the year.
Pay
McKesson offers a competitive compensation package, including base pay, annual bonus, and long-term incentive opportunities. The base pay range for this position is $79,600 - $132,600, determined by performance, experience, skills, and geographical markets.
